What's the best way to take out a personal loan while being unemployed? |
i lost my job due to kidney stones ( i missed a lot of days while during my 3mo probation period ) and now my Credit card bill is going up and up and up. i need to pay it off so that i don't mess up my credit, h'm only 19 and i need to take out a small loan only about $1000 or so. what should i do? any website suggestions?? No one is going to give you a personal loan if you are unemployed - especially if it to pay bills. Give your head a shake Britney. Who is going to lend you money while you are out of work. probably your credit cards are your best bet. since you're young, it would probably serve you best to find some place cheap to live for a while, in order to get your financial situation worked out.. friends or family. don't worry about messing up your credit right now. worry about getting a job. Call the credit card companies and tell them about your situation. They are usually willing to help. If you do not get a handle on this now it will haunt you for years to come! Get your credit card company fax number, but before you do that, please find out who is handling your account also find out who is the manger of the department that is handling your credit card account .talk to the manger and explain what happen and fax the information regarding your job and kidney stone problems to the manger ,please keep proof for yourself. Once you have spoken to the manger and gotten the required information that you and he/she would need ,try to set-up a small payment amount maybe 10.00 for the first month and maybe 10.00 or 20.00 the second month to at least pay on it. Not paying anything will hurt you in the future. You know you probaly can get your job back as long as ou can show proof of yourmedical probelm. Talk to the head people in charge there is also some one who is higher than the regular mangers. Go seecan you get your job back if you want that job okay Also find out did your card have some kind of credit protection insurance that would pay the minmum monthly payments while you are sick and unable to work. Once you made some type of arrangment with the manger, make sure that he/she would agree not to report your late payments to the credit report company and if anything have been reported make sure they agree that once you have paid in good standing and kept a agrrement that they go back and report it to the creit report companies that your account have came back in good standing this want ruin your credit.
